Ruckus In Rajya Sabha Over Petrol And Diesel Prices

Ruckus in Rajya Sabha over petrol and diesel prices, PM Modi holds meeting with Union Ministers: Budget Session 2022.

The echo of rising inflation in the country is being heard in Parliament. During the second phase of the Budget Session of Parliament, there was a huge uproar in the Rajya Sabha on Tuesday.

Leaders of opposition parties created a ruckus over the increased prices of petrol, diesel, and LPG. Due to this, the proceedings of the Rajya Sabha had to be adjourned till 12 noon.

Petrol, diesel, and LPG prices increased.

The issue of petrol-diesel and expensive LPG may arise in the Rajya Sabha.

Let us inform you that on Tuesday, the prices of petrol and diesel have been increased by 80 paise per liter while the price of domestic LPG cylinder has been increased by Rs 50.

Petrol and diesel prices have increased in the country after 137 days. Earlier, fuel prices were hiked on November 4.

Now the price of petrol in the capital Delhi is Rs 96.21 per liter while the price of diesel has gone up to Rs 87.47 per liter.

At the same time, the price of LPG cylinders in Delhi and Mumbai has gone up to Rs 949.50.
